Sibling / Child Loss Group
We offer a free group night for those families who have experienced the death of a child/ sibling. While parents meet in a group, children and teens meet with other bereaved siblings, ages 5-18. These groups run twice monthly, starting at 6:00 pm with a pizza dinner, and run for approximately two hours. Each group is facilitated by a clinician and a grief-informed volunteer.

Young Adult Group
Our YA Group supports individuals between the ages of 18 and 30 who have experienced a meaningful death loss. This free, virtual group is held twice monthly, on zoom, on Thursdays at 6:30 pm.
Grandparent Grief Support Group
This daytime group is designed for grandparents supporting a grieving grandchild. This free, virtual group is held twice monthly, on zoom, on Mondays at 4 pm.

Individual Counseling
We recognize that not everyone feels comfortable in a group setting or sometimes might need more individualized support as everyone grieves in their own unique way. We offer grief counseling to individuals on a sliding scale from $0-150 per hour as needed and available. We cannot accept insurances because we do not use diagnostic codes.

Family Consultations
Sometimes, finding the right words to talk to a child about death is hard. We offer family consultations to help support and guide that conversation. Our initial consultations by phone or in person are free of charge. For more information, email [email protected].
